6-story residential building completed in 1890. Designed by Charles Rentz, it is clad in red brick above a cast-iron storefront. The windows are grouped together by means of a projecting band course. The adjoining building to the south was built at the same time, and aligns with this one at the cornice level. These two structures, of similar appearance, unify the block. They were both renovated in 1987. The ground floor is occupied by Maison Martin Margiela men's boutique.
